Latest Patents: Robert J. Grabske holds a patent for monoclonal antibodies specific to and capable of distinguishing between hemoglobin S and hemoglobin A. This groundbreaking invention provides valuable methods for the production and application of these antibodies. These antibodies not only show a high degree of specificity but also demonstrate greater affinity for hemoglobin S, making them suitable for labeling human red blood cells. This capability paves the way for flow cytometric detection of hemoglobin genotypes and allows for the enumeration of circulating red blood cells that may have undergone somatic mutations.
